Good inhaler, but it could have a medication cupNov 20, 2009 It is a good product overall, but you can't use anything except KAZ pads with this product. I have a cold and I want to use some medications (liquid and drops), but it doesn't allow to put anything into the water. Also it comes only with 1 menthol pad, so make sure that you ordered them as well. It says that you need to use more than 1 pad or put 1 pad into the water under the cup. Also you can't use them more than once. Pack of 6 pads is $7. It is the same system like with toners for printers. Even if the printer is cheap, toner will eat all the money.

Great product, needs re-engineeringOct 22, 2009 We have owned this product for many years and have found it very effective in preventing and treating colds, bronchitis, and sinus infections. However, we owned the previously made product by KAZ and found it to be a much superior product for the same purpose. Sadly, Vicks bought the KAZ product and KAZ no longer makes the old version. The Vicks product plastic cone (that you put your face into) has an odd angle for face placement, and is too tall/high and easily tips, thus spilling boiling water onto your lap or chest. Be careful with this and wear a thick blanket "bib" to protect yourself from burns. Be sure to supervise children who use this product. We did not have this same stability problem with the KAZ made product. That being said. This product is still extremely effective in treating upper respiratory problems, much cheaper than medications and drugs, and much better for the body. Product states that you can put eucalyptus (mentholatum or vicks type products) into the water, but know that these products shuts down the cillia movement in the nasal passages and bronchial tubes, and is counterproductive.
